传单可以在R中使用,但不能在浏览器中使用

传单可以在R中使用,但不能在浏览器中使用,r,leaflet,R,Leaflet,以下内容适用于R,但不适用于浏览器 library(leaflet) data(quakes) map = leaflet(data = quakes[1:20,]) %>% addTiles() %>% addMarkers(~long, ~lat, popup = ~as.character(mag), label = ~as.character(mag)) 浏览器仅显示标记的位置。我已禁用所有浏览器扩展 问题:如何显示基础地

以下内容适用于R,但不适用于浏览器

library(leaflet)
data(quakes)

map = leaflet(data = quakes[1:20,]) %>% 
      addTiles() %>%
      addMarkers(~long, ~lat, 
          popup = ~as.character(mag), label = ~as.character(mag))
浏览器仅显示标记的位置。我已禁用所有浏览器扩展

问题:如何显示基础地图

会话信息:

R version 3.3.3 (2017-03-06)
Platform: x86_64-pc-linux-gnu (64-bit)
Running under: Linux Mint 18.1

locale:
 [1] LC_CTYPE=en_US.UTF-8       LC_NUMERIC=C               LC_TIME=en_US.UTF-8        LC_COLLATE=en_US.UTF-8     LC_MONETARY=en_US.UTF-8    LC_MESSAGES=en_US.UTF-8    LC_PAPER=en_US.UTF-8       LC_NAME=C                 
 [9] LC_ADDRESS=C               LC_TELEPHONE=C             LC_MEASUREMENT=en_US.UTF-8 LC_IDENTIFICATION=C       

attached base packages:
[1] stats     graphics  grDevices utils     datasets  methods   base     

other attached packages:
[1] leaflet_1.1.0

loaded via a namespace (and not attached):
 [1] htmlwidgets_0.8 shiny_1.0.0     magrittr_1.5    R6_2.2.0        htmltools_0.3.5 tools_3.3.3     Rcpp_0.12.10    crosstalk_1.0.0 digest_0.6.12   xtable_1.8-2    httpuv_1.3.3    mime_0.5   

从默认地图分幅提供程序获取地图分幅时似乎出错

在传单包中纠正此问题之前,我建议使用另一个地图平铺提供商,例如:

map = leaflet(quakes[1:20,]) %>% 
addProviderTiles(providers$Esri.NatGeoWorldMap) %>% 
  addMarkers(~long, ~lat, 
             popup = ~as.character(mag), label = ~as.character(mag))
map

此处提供了可用地图平铺提供程序的完整列表:

您的意思是您无法在链接的网站上看到基础地图,但如果您在R中本地运行它,您可以吗?如果是的话,这是否意味着问题出在你的浏览器而不是R上?是的,可能是的。你尝试过不同的浏览器吗?是的,在Opera、Firefox(Linux)和MS Internet Explorer中。